  • Title

    Dual-axis driving and interference forces analysis for high sensitivity objective lens actuator

  • Abstract
    As the mechanical and electrical device adjusting the objective lens, driven by dual-axis forces, the lens actuator must provide a precise means of accurately following the disk displacement in the focusing and tracking directions in a digital DVD pickup head. To study the driving and interference forces and improve the driving sensitivity of the lens actuator, we put forward a new calculation method in this paper. Compared with the traditional finite element method, the new method can be conveniently used to obtain the most exact result on the dual-axis driving and interference forces, which cannot be easily dealt with using the finite element method. Important conclusions are given and a typical experiment verifies the validity of the-new method
